What if the world suddenly stopped spinning? Would the entire human race cease to exist? What if your house were hit by a falling tree, or a tornado, or a bolt of lightning?

What if you got sick and couldn't look after your elderly parent any longer? What if something happened to your spouse, and you found yourself suddenly alone? Decisions which you shared with your spouse before, you would have to make alone. What if you made the wrong decision?

What if? What if? What if?

The "what if" questions confront us almost every day, without answers.

This type of questions can go on and on, bringing fear and negativity into our minds.

God's Word says:

Isaiah 41:10 – So do not fear, for I am with you; do not be d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you; I will uphold you with my righteous right hand. (NIV)

Proverbs 3:5-6 – Trust in the Lord with all your heart and lean not on your own understanding; in all your ways acknowledge him, and he will make your paths straight. (NIV)

Let us give the "what ifs" to God. He knows our future. He knows what is best for us.

Prayer: Lord God, we want so much to give our worries to You, but sometimes, we find that very hard to do. Remind us that You are always with us and You love us, even when we question Your will for our lives. Thank You. Amen.
